Map: ‘Planetensystem’ (Solar System.) It shows the relative postitions of the planets in our solar system, the distances between the planets, and the sizes of the major planets. This original print originates from the 6th edition of the famous German encyclopedia Meyers’ Konversationslexikon, and was published 1902-1920. Meyers Konversations-Lexikon was a major German encyclopedia that existed in various editions from 1839 until 1984, when it merged with the Brockhaus encyclopedia. The same prints were used for similar publications, such as Brockhaus’ encyclopedia, and the Dutch encyclopedias of Oosthoek and Winkler Prins.Artists and Engravers: The original founder and publisher who initiated this famous encyclopedia was Joseph Meyer (1796-1856, Hildburghausen, Germany).
